Transaction d18aeba362448ce3249f42eb9cb82b5384f14e4dd3dd1ea80fa86e243ffa9914

3 Input
2 Outputs
  • d18aeba362448ce3249f42eb9cb82b5384f14e4dd3dd1ea80fa86e243ffa9914:0
  • value  157703
    address  3A3aMrJK2rmjA9pNr9xFZ1X7JLFp3ar85k
  • d18aeba362448ce3249f42eb9cb82b5384f14e4dd3dd1ea80fa86e243ffa9914:1
  • value  3712397
    address  3K7PPf3u4yWYrC2p6hkhPttTFUfTZ9hsdL